Job Introduction
Heritage Portfolio are looking for a talented and enthusiastic Chef de Partie to join the team at our Central Production Kitchen in Leith, Edinburgh. We operate within some of Scotland’s leading cultural destinations, including Royal Botanic Garden Edinburgh, The Scottish National Portrait Gallery, V&A Dundee, Mansfield Traquair, the Signet Library and Perth and Musselburgh Racecourses.
With an emphasis on fresh, made from scratch cooking, our culinary teams execute outstanding catering and event services, from private dining, weddings and corporate clients to exceptional in-house café services. Under the guidance of our Head Chef and culinary development team, you will prepare and deliver a range of menus, from deli style retail offers to high end fine dining experiences, all with our overarching ethos of quality, seasonality, provenance and flavour at their heart.

About The Company
Heritage Portfolio is the sub-segment of Sodexo Live! that produces outstanding catering and event services for our cultural destinations. These include exceptional “in-house” café services in some of Britain’s leading visitor attractions such as V&A Dundee, The Signet Library, Portrait Gallery, private parties and dining, weddings and prestigious events.
Our mantra is “Never standing still” and as we grow and flourish in the world of bespoke events and venues, we remain true to our original ethos: to provide an amazing experience that goes beyond the remarkable food we serve.
